tiornys Dec 5, 2014 @ 8:22pm 
Short version: use Earth element damage reduction (or physical damage reduction) to protect yourself from stomp damage, use Fang's Highwind to kill the legs, and try to stack buffs, debuffs, and chain percentage to kill him off in a single fall.

DiM Dec 5, 2014 @ 8:33pm 
Originally posted by tiornys:
Short version: use Earth element damage reduction (or physical damage reduction) to protect yourself from stomp damage.

This, get some Gaian Rings/Clay Rings/General/Champ Belts/Royal/Imperial Armlets/ Etc. Any of these will help immensely when dealing with his stomp dmg.

You say your not doing enough dmg to him when he is staggered, just debuff him real fast then go all out. Like SAB/RAV/SAB to roll out debuffs and get that chain up, then switch to COM/COM/COM to burn him down fast. If you still can't put out enough dmg, then buff yourself with some fortisol before battle.

tiornys Dec 5, 2014 @ 9:26pm 
Daze (in addition to its normal function) doubles the damage of the next attack that hits the Dazed target. That attack will dispel Daze, but Daze does have a short minimum duration, which means you get double damage from every attack that happens while a SAB is spamming and successfully inflicting Daze. A staggered Adamantoise or Adamantortoise has a high enough chain to give Daze a 100% chance of success. Therefore, with proper attack timing, the SAB will double the damage of your COMs, giving you effectively 4xCOM damage, which is clearly superior to 3xCOM damage.

In practice, it's difficult to completely sync up everyone, but even with imperfect sync you can deal more damage than you could with COM/COM/COM, and you get this benefit without having to worry about the attack stats of your Daze-spammer, opening up easy accessory space for things like Collector Catalog, Growth Egg, etc. Furthermore, this approach doubles the effectiveness of your first two tier 3 weapon upgrades (within the context of this fight) if you're choosing to develop weapons that far.
